The funeral of a Portstewart father-of-two, whose body was found in the River Bann on Monday, takes place later.
56 year old John Thompson, originally from Ballyclare, went missing in Portstewart last weekend.
He'd worked in insurance and was also a well-known musician.
Following a 10.30am service at Ballylinney Presbyterian Church, Mr Thompson will be buried in Ballyclare Cemetery.
